Hospitality management training refers to educational programs and courses designed to equip individuals with the skills, knowledge, and competencies needed to effectively operate within the hospitality industry. These programs typically cover areas such as hotel and restaurant management, customer service, hospitality marketing, event planning, and business administration, preparing students for careers in hotels, resorts, restaurants, event venues, and other service-oriented establishments.
Key Features
- Comprehensive curriculum covering hospitality operations, management principles, and customer service
- Practical training opportunities through internships and industry placements
- Focus on leadership, communication, and problem-solving skills
- Accreditation by recognized educational bodies or industry organizations
- Flexibility via online and on-campus learning options
- Networking opportunities with industry professionals
Pros
- Prepares students for a diverse range of career paths in the hospitality sector
- Provides practical experience to enhance employability
- Develops essential soft skills such as communication and leadership
- Industry-recognized certifications can boost career prospects
Cons
- Can be costly with significant tuition fees
- Quality and comprehensiveness vary across different programs
- Intense competition for internships and job placements
- Rapid industry changes require continuous upskilling beyond training
